Ben Stokes named in Lions squad

England selectors today named a 12-man England Lions squad, which includes Durham’s Ben Stokes, to face West Indies in a four day fixture at Northampton commencing Thursday May 10.

James Taylor will captain a side that includes Michael Carberry and Samit Patel who have both represented England at Test level.

Nine of the squad toured Bangladesh or Sri Lanka with England Lions last winter with Carberry, Nick Compton and Ben Stokes also included.

The only player in the squad uncapped at England Lions level is Matt Coles who spent the winter on the Potential England Performance Programme in Loughborough and Chennai before being added to the Lions squad for the final stages of the tour.

National Selector, Geoff Miller, said: “Many of the players included in this squad have worked hard on our overseas tours and training camps over the winter or have shown good early season form. West Indies will no doubt be challenging opposition and this fixture will present an opportunity for players to show that they are capable of taking the next step and representing England at Test level in the future.”

 

 

James Taylor (Nottinghamshire) (Captain)
Jonny Bairstow (Yorkshire)
Jack Brooks (Northamptonshire)
Michael Carberry (Hampshire)
Matt Coles (Kent)
Nick Compton (Somerset)
Jade Dernbach (Surrey)
Simon Kerrigan (Lancashire)
Stuart Meaker (Surrey)
Samit Patel (Nottinghamshire)
Joe Root (Yorkshire)
Ben Stokes (Durham)
